PRIMELAND HOTEL
10/10 Excellent
"Primeland is a small first class boutique hotel and highly recommended. Its 3 star rating belies its quality. The only drawback is that the very clean standard double rooms, although very well appointed, are small. This can easily be overcome by booking a twin room (for a few pounds more) and requesting the removal of the single bed. The breakfast is limited but quite adequate and the lunch / dinner menu extensive for the size of the hotel. The grilled Nile Perch is highly recommended as is the Beef Pizza but all the food is both well cooked and presented, with local representatives. The Beef Samosas are equal to any in the subcontinent or souks of the Middle East. The service is most attentive. The swimming pool, while not Olympic size, is more than large enough for recreational swimming and has a bar area adjoining. The pool, which can be viewed from the restaurant has alternating colour lighting in the evening. The hotel building and pool are surrounded by a pleasant and varied well kept garden. It is located in an area outside the centre with indigenous shops and housing but is only a 7 minute (€1.5) tuktuk ride from the town centre and the local Mbuyeni market. Finally, and by no means least, in appropriate cloud conditions it has an excellent view of the peak of Kilimanjaro above a local foreground of trees. A self parking area is provided within the walled security area which is controlled by a Masai guard as well as a local uniformed security company.10+/10."
